Sanbornton Central School is Hiring a Special Education Paraprofessionals - Sanbornton Central School Near Sanbornton, NH

Sanbornton Central School is hiring Special Education Paraprofessionals for the 2023-2024 school year. Paraprofessionals perform duties that are instructional in nature or deliver direct services to students in conjunction with the Special Education and/or classroom Teacher to implement educational programs and services appropriate to student's needs. Special Education Paraprofessionals are compassionate individuals who provide assistance to students with disabilities, as determined by the IEP team. Level II Paraeducator licensure through the New Hampshire Department of Education is required, or must be obtained within 30 days of employment to comply with federal Title I credential requirements.Application accepted until positions are filledRate of pay: starting at $14.90/hour, $15.90 if Para II CertifiedQualifications:* High school diploma or equivalent* Strong written and oral communication skillsResponsibilities:* Provide assistance to students with a variety of disabilities.* Supervise students in school settings.* Collaborate with special education, regular education teachers, and Administration to coordinate instruction and support for students. * Assist children individually or in small groups to increase their skills in academic, social, emotional, and behavioral competencies.* Documentation and data collection duties affiliated with Medicaid claims, student Positive Behavior Intervention Plans, etc. * Participate in professional development activities, workshops, courses, and district-provided training to develop professional competence for the benefit of students and maintain NHDOE licensure.* Enforce and follow school district policies and rules.* Collaborate to perform assigned duties with classroom teacher to coordinate instructional efforts on behalf of disabled students.EOE
